Place one redstone dust in the bottom box of the middle column on the crafting grid. Iron ingots are the backbone of crafting rails in Minecraft. You'll need a total of 6 iron ingots to create 16 rails. To obtain iron ingots, you'll need to mine iron ore blocks.

Remember, you must use a stone pickaxe or better to mine iron ore, as wooden or gold pickaxes won't yield any ore. Once you've collected iron ore, place it in the top slot of a furnace and add fuel to the bottom slot. The furnace will then smelt the iron ore into iron ingots. This design requires the track to be set by default to let the cart through. To build, a tripwire is attached to hooks one block above the track. Two blocks further is a junction which is set by default to turn empty carts back to the station. An empty minecart does not trigger the tripwire, so it is sent back.

You will need lots of iron and wood to build your rails. You will also need gold and redstone for powered rails, unless you're OK with only going downhill. A block placed above the track at the downhill end of a ramp prevents minecarts from traveling down the slope, but not up. For a minecart to move down a diagonal tunnel, there must be clearance sufficient for a player to walk it.

A dispenser loaded with fire charges break minecart entities, dropping them as items. Placing a detector rail above a hopper, with the dispenser facing the detector rail, collects minecarts as items, which can then be stored in a chest or routed to a cart dispenser. A detector rail could also be used to activate an event based on a cart's location. For example, a fail-safe can be created to release a stopped cart in order to prevent a collision with an arriving cart. The arriving cart passes over a detector rail, activating a powered rail that boosts the resting cart away.

Consecutive powered rails on a slope adds more momentum, so eight powered rails can be followed by 8 normal rails to maintain full speed while traveling up the slope. Less momentum is gained by each consecutive rail as the strip gets longer. Such a cart does not have enough momentum to climb an 11 block high slope. An empty cart in a similar setup can climb only 5 blocks and then travel a few blocks horizontally. You'll need just one stick to complete your rail recipe. Start by placing wooden planks in a 2x2 grid in the crafting table, which will yield four wooden planks. Then, place two wooden planks on top of each other in the crafting grid to create four sticks. With a rail in hand, right-click the ground to place it. If you make a mistake, just hit it with a pickaxe to pick it back up. Rails will automatically turn corners when you place a rail adjacent to another. Note, however, that you can't turn a corner when the track is on a slope.
